News
12m
Irish Mirror on MSNIreland increased enforcement of immigration law at fastest rate of any EU member state last yearNew figures published by the European Commission show the rate of increase by Ireland in unsuccessful international ...
When Chinese automaker BYD Co. announced plans to build a massive factory in the hardscrabble city of Camacari, in Brazil’s northeastern Bahia state, locals saw a new beginning 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results